Puntos clave
Improved metabolic homeostasis is linked to the action of the micropeptide LEAO in adipose tissue, indicating an important role in energy regulation.
The analysis demonstrated significant changes in adipose tissue plasticity with LEAO treatment, improving various metabolic parameters.
Assessment using biomarker analysis highlights the potential pathways influenced by LEAO on energy balance and metabolism.
These findings may enable new therapeutic strategies targeting adipose tissue for metabolic disorders.
